A Workshop with Isto and Emily Eagen Saturday October 28th 5 PM - 7 PM
In this workshop, open to singers, guitarists (or other strumming instruments), and those who do both, we will learn songs from Volume 1, Disc 1 of Harry Smith's famous Anthology of American Folk Music, the collection of blues, country and folk music recordings from the 1920s and 30s that was an integral part of the folk revival of the 50s and 60s, and has inspired generations of musicians. Students can expect to learn a collection of songs that will enable them to start performing in their own Jalopy-style music groups. Chord/lyric sheets will be handed out for all the songs we look at, as well as vocal parts and guitar tablature for some of the songs.
Open to anybody who knows the basic chords on the guitar. If you are comfortable with the following chords, you'll be fine: G, C, D, A, E, F, Em, Am, Dm, E7, A7, D7, B7. We'll encounter some other material along the way, but those chords should be enough to start with.
